Solid Waste Management in Accra Waste Generation Accra generates nearly 900,000 metric tons of solid waste per year,1 approximately 67% of which is organic matter.5 The rate of waste generation is approximately 0.5 kilograms per person per day.1 Waste Collection Solid waste collection in Accra is mostly privatized.
